// STALE_BRANCH_AGE_DAYS
// Used by Brambleworth, our stale-branch cleanup bot. Branches older
// than this with no open review get archived, not deleted — recovery
// is always possible. New folks: don't lower this without asking the
// Fennick team first. Each bot run stamps its trace token, shown below.

pipeline stamp: htk21_0e1a1ddcdb5bfd88d6dd6

## Deploying the Gatewick Proctor Queue

Deploys are pretty painless: push to main, wait for the pipeline, then watch the queue drain dashboard for five minutes. If candidates pile up mid-exam, roll back first and ask questions later — the queue replays safely. Everything the workers care about lives in one config block, shown here for reference.

settings of bafof-yagef:
JOROX_PIN=8740
JOROX_TENANT=pelox
JOROX_METRICS_HOST=metrics.jorox.qorvelworks.internal
JOROX_SEAL=seal_c78f63c1
JOROX_STANDBY_TEAM=norax

Subject: Marlowe Retail Pilot — quick update

Hi all,

Good news: the pilot with Bexfield Stores is officially on. Twelve locations across the Carrow Valley region go live next month with our Shelfline units. Their ops lead is enthusiastic, and early numbers from the demo week looked strong. Sales leads, keep this close for now. Details on where we take this next are below.

management briefing: Istaelix Group is in early talks to buy Sorysax Logistics for about $496.2 million. The Kasox launch date is October 3, and nothing goes to the press before then. Legal wants the Norokax Foods term sheet withdrawn before April 25.

# Env notes for weekly eng sync — Pondworks pool changes
# Context: connection pool exhaustion on the Marlin DB last Tuesday.
# Pool size capped at 40 per worker; idle timeout cut to 30s.
# PgShield proxy now sits in front of the primary; all services must
# authenticate to the proxy, not the DB directly.
# Old DB password vars are dead. Discussion points in sync doc.
# The proxy credential is set by the line below.

sealed setting: VAULT_KEY20=69e2a0b23f1a79fbf692